site stats

Bitwise tricks

WebApr 27, 2016 · Time Complexity: O(1) Auxiliary Space: O(1) Bit Tricks for Competitive Programming Refer BitWise Operators Articles for more articles on Bit Hacks.. This article is contributed by Pankaj Mishra.If you like GeeksforGeeks and would like to contribute, you … In competitive programming or in general, some problems seem difficult but can be … Print the Longest Subarray whose Bitwise AND is maximum. Easy. Given a … The bitwise XOR operator is the most useful operator from a technical interview … Web1 hour ago · By Buffalo Rising April 14, 2024 0 Comments 1 Min Read. Douglas Development is moving forward with renovations to 368 Sycamore Street which will …

The Art of Computer Programming - Stanford University

WebAwesome Bitwise Operations and Tricks with Examples. 1. Set n th bit of integer x. x (1< WebIn computer programming, a bitwise operation operates on a bit string, a bit array or a binary numeral (considered as a bit string) at the level of its individual bits.It is a fast and simple action, basic to the higher-level arithmetic operations and directly supported by the processor.Most bitwise operations are presented as two-operand instructions where the … tsa frozen water https://gpstechnologysolutions.com

Power Programming: Bitwise Tips and Tricks - Open …

WebA bitwise operation operates on one or more bit patterns or binary numerals at the level of their individual bits.It is a fast, primitive action directly supported by the central processing unit (CPU), and is used to manipulate values for comparisons and calculations.. On most processors, the majority of bitwise operations are single cycle - substantially faster than … WebBitwise Operators: There are different bitwise operations used in the bit manipulation. These bit operations operate on the individual bits of the bit patterns. Bit operations are fast and can be used in optimizing time complexity. ... Tricks with Bits: 1) x ^ ( x & (x-1)) : Returns the rightmost 1 in binary representation of x. WebMar 10, 2024 · Bitwise Tricks. Now, let’s look at a few tricks you can do using bitwise operators. These are often used as interview questions to check if you’ve reviewed basic bit manipulation and can apply it to day-to-day coding tasks. Check if a number is even. This one tests your knowledge of how AND works and how even/odd numbers differ in binary. tsa fruity pebbles acro

cout statement in C++ Display output in C++

Category:10 cool bitwise operator hacks and tricks every programmer

Tags:Bitwise tricks

Bitwise tricks

Bitwise Operation Tricks in React Source Code - Medium

WebSign extending from a constant bit-width Sign extension is automatic for built-in types, such as chars and ints. But suppose you have a signed two's complement number, x, that is … WebApr 5, 2024 · The &amp; operator is overloaded for two types of operands: number and BigInt.For numbers, the operator returns a 32-bit integer. For BigInts, the operator returns a BigInt. …

Bitwise tricks

Did you know?

WebMay 30, 2024 · The bitwise XOR operator is the most useful operator from technical interview perspective. ... Bit tricks. Bitwise Operators. Competitive Programming----4. More from Shashank Mohabia. WebMay 26, 2024 · Bitwise Operation Tricks in React Source Code. React is a popular front-end framework, and its performance has a significant impact on countless front-end …

WebBitwise tricks. Raw. bitwise-operators.md. Inspired by this article . Neat tricks for speeding up integer computations. Note: cin.sync_with_stdio (false); disables … WebFeb 16, 2013 · &amp; is the bitwise AND operator. &amp;&amp; is the logical AND operator. In binary, if the digits bit is set (i.e one), the number is odd. In binary, if the digits bit is zero , the number is even. (number &amp; 1) is a bitwise AND test of the digits bit. Another way to do this (and possibly less efficient but more understandable) is using the modulus ...

WebProgramming. Let's not forget the canonical list of bit-twiddling hacks . Compare and swap, without clobbering the original values. If you have three items, a, b, and x, and x will be a clone of a or b, it switches which one x … WebBitwise Industries. Jul 2024 - Present1 year 10 months. United States. Bitwise Industries creates a bridge between humans from marginalized communities and stories of systemic poverty to skills ...

WebMay 14, 2024 · Bitwise AND is extremely useful for checking for the presence of bits set to 1, and spoiler alert, it’s the tool we’ll be using for our bit map problem. But let’s explore …

WebBitwise tricks. Raw. bitwise-operators.md. Inspired by this article . Neat tricks for speeding up integer computations. Note: cin.sync_with_stdio (false); disables synchronous IO and gives you a performance boost. If used, you should only use cin for reading input (don't use both cin and scanf when sync is disabled, for example) or you will get ... tsaftsoufexpressWebVolume 4 Fascicle 1, Bitwise Tricks & Techniques; Binary Decision Diagrams (2009), xiii+261pp. ISBN 0-321-58050-8 Volume 4 Fascicle 2, Generating All Tuples and Permutations (2005), v+128pp. ISBN 0-201-85393-0 Volume 4 Fascicle 3, Generating All Combinations and Partitions (2005), vi+150pp. ISBN 0-201-85394-9 phil lowreyWebCounting set bits, finding lowest/highest set bit, finding nth-from-top/bottom set bit and others can be useful, and it's worth looking at the bit-twiddling hacks site.. That said, this … tsa fruity spliceWebPython bitwise operators are defined for the following built-in data types: int. bool. set and frozenset. dict (since Python 3.9) It’s not a widely known fact, but bitwise operators can perform operations from set algebra, such as union, intersection, and symmetric difference, as well as merge and update dictionaries. tsa furloughWebMar 27, 2012 · This trick applies to languages that have a unary bitwise negation operator ~ and a unary regular negation operator -. If your program, by chance, contains the expression -x-1, you can replace it with ~x to save bytes. This doesn't occur all too often, but watch what happens if we negate (-) both expressions: x+1 equals -~x! Similarly, x-1 ... tsa fruity pebblesWebMay 18, 2024 · Number (x), parseFloat (x) and +x will all give x as a floating-point number. parseInt (x) will give x as an integer. x 0 and x >> 0 will give x as a signed 32-bit integer. (In general, this applies to most bitwise operators.) x >>> 0 will give x as an unsigned 32-bit integer. I would recommend that you use Number, parseFloat or parseInt ... tsa ft wayne str 1604 decatur inWebLearn about bit manipulation. This video is a part of HackerRank's Cracking The Coding Interview Tutorial with Gayle Laakmann McDowell.http://www.hackerrank.... tsagency.com